Is Mcdonald's Ice Cream Plastic? Unraveling The Myth Behind The Treat

is mcdonalds ice cream made of plastic

The question of whether McDonald's ice cream is made of plastic has sparked widespread curiosity and debate, fueled by viral social media claims and urban legends. While the idea of plastic in ice cream seems far-fetched, it stems from observations about the texture and consistency of McDonald's soft-serve, which some claim feels unusually smooth or synthetic. These rumors often point to the use of stabilizers, emulsifiers, or other additives in the ice cream mix, which are common in processed foods. However, McDonald's has consistently denied these claims, stating that their ice cream is made from real dairy ingredients and meets all food safety standards. Despite this, the myth persists, highlighting the public's growing skepticism about fast food ingredients and the power of misinformation in the digital age.

Ingredients Analysis: Examines McDonald's ice cream ingredients for plastic or synthetic components

McDonald's ice cream ingredients list raises questions about potential plastic or synthetic components. A closer look at the official list reveals no direct mention of plastics like polyethylene or polypropylene. However, terms like "cellulose gum" and "mono and diglycerides" often spark concern. Cellulose gum, derived from plant fibers, is a common stabilizer, not a plastic. Mono and diglycerides, while synthetically produced, are emulsifiers sourced from natural fats and safe for consumption.

Analyzing these ingredients requires understanding their origins and functions. For instance, cellulose gum prevents ice cream from crystallizing, ensuring a smooth texture. Its plant-based nature distinguishes it from synthetic plastics. Similarly, mono and diglycerides, though processed, are FDA-approved and widely used in food products. Their role is to blend ingredients that would otherwise separate, such as oil and water.

A comparative approach highlights how McDonald's ingredients align with industry standards. Many ice cream brands use similar stabilizers and emulsifiers, often derived from natural sources but processed synthetically. For example, cellulose gum is also found in premium ice cream brands, dispelling the myth of plastic additives. The key takeaway is that "synthetic" does not equate to "harmful" when these components are regulated and serve functional purposes.

Texture Misconceptions: Explains why the ice cream's consistency is mistaken for plastic

McDonald's ice cream texture often sparks curiosity, with some mistaking its consistency for plastic. This misconception arises from the smooth, almost waxy mouthfeel that contrasts with traditional, airier ice creams. The culprit? A combination of factors, including the use of stabilizers like carrageenan and guar gum, which prevent ice crystal formation and create a denser product. These additives are common in commercial ice creams but are often misunderstood, leading to unfounded claims of "plastic" ingredients.

To understand why this texture is misconstrued, consider the science behind ice cream consistency. Traditional ice creams contain up to 50% air, known as overrun, which contributes to their light, fluffy texture. McDonald’s ice cream, however, has a lower overrun, typically around 30-40%, resulting in a denser, creamier product. This density, combined with the smooth finish from stabilizers, can feel unnatural to those accustomed to airier varieties. For instance, a scoop of McDonald’s ice cream holds its shape longer, a trait some mistake for plasticity rather than recognizing it as a result of reduced air incorporation.

Another factor fueling this misconception is the ice cream’s ability to resist melting. McDonald’s ice cream is formulated to maintain its structure in high-volume, fast-paced environments, which requires a higher melting point. This is achieved through precise temperature control during production and the use of emulsifiers, not plastic. For comparison, a typical homemade ice cream melts within minutes at room temperature, while McDonald’s version retains its form longer. This durability, while practical for their operations, can lead consumers to question its naturalness.

Frequently asked questions

No, McDonald's ice cream is not made of plastic. It is made from dairy ingredients like milk, cream, and sugar, along with flavorings and stabilizers commonly used in ice cream production.

Misinformation and rumors have spread online, often based on the ice cream's texture or consistency. However, there is no evidence to support the claim that it contains plastic.

McDonald's ice cream contains typical ice cream ingredients, including stabilizers like guar gum and carrageenan, which are plant-based and commonly used in food products. These are not plastic.

The slow melting of McDonald's ice cream is due to its formulation and the use of stabilizers, not plastic. These ingredients help maintain texture and consistency, especially in a fast-food setting.

Yes, McDonald's has publicly debunked the plastic rumor, confirming that their ice cream is made from dairy and standard ice cream ingredients, with no plastic involved.
